Job Description:

The Youth Engagement Officer will be responsible for community-based mobilization and youth engagement activities under the Adolescent and Youth Friendly Space (AYFS) project. The position will ensure meaningful, inclusive, and sustained participation of adolescents and youth across assigned project districts in line with approved project objectives and guidelines.

Main Responsibilities:

Youth Mobilization & Engagement:

  • Mobilize adolescents and youth through structured outreach and engagement activities.
  • Facilitate youth participation in awareness sessions, dialogue forums, and project-led initiatives.
  • Support inclusion of marginalized and vulnerable youth in project activities.

Community Coordination:

  • Liaise with community leaders, youth groups, educational institutions, and other relevant stakeholders.
  • Support formation and strengthening of youth groups and youth-led initiatives.
  • Coordinate closely with AYFS staff and project teams to ensure alignment between community and centre-based activities.

Reporting & Documentation:

  • Maintain accurate records of outreach and engagement activities.
  • Prepare and submit periodic activity reports and supporting documentation to the Project Coordinator.

Other Responsibilities:

  • Participate in project trainings, coordination meetings, and review sessions.
  • Perform any other duties assigned by the Project Coordinator in support of project objectives

Job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in social sciences, Development Studies, Education, or a relevant field.
  • Minimum of 2 years’ experience in community mobilization or youth engagement programs
  • Strong field coordination and community engagement skills.
  • Ability to engage adolescents and youth effectively in diverse community settings.
  • Strong documentation, reporting, and record-keeping abilities.
  • Ability to plan and implement field activities independently.
  • Excellent communication, liaison, and stakeholder management skills.
  • Ability to work under pressure, meet deadlines, and manage multiple tasks.
  • Problem-solving, time management, and interpersonal skills.
  • High standards of professionalism, integrity, and confidentiality
